/plushcap/analysis/hashicorp/nomad-bench-load-testing-and-benchmarking-for-nomad

Nomad Bench: Load testing and benchmarking for Nomad

What's this blog post about?

Nomad Bench is an open-source tool designed to load test and benchmark HashiCorp's Nomad, a simple and highly scalable cluster manager. It provides reusable infrastructure automation for running large-scale test scenarios on clusters at scale, enabling users to better understand how Nomad scales and uncover problems that only appear in large cluster deployments. The nomad-bench project consists of two main components: the core cluster and the test cluster. Data collection is facilitated by InfluxDB, which allows for real-time data analysis and monitoring via dashboards. nomad-nodesim is a lightweight tool used to simulate and run hundreds of processes per application instance, allowing users to simulate thousands of Nomad clients without having to stand up thousands of real hosts. The team validated the performance of nomad-nodesim by running experiments with both real and simulated clients, confirming that it performs similarly to real clients.

Company
HashiCorp

Date published
July 16, 2024

Author(s)
Piotr Kazmierczak

Word count
1060

Hacker News points
None found.

Language
English


By Matt Makai. 2021-2024.